Sometimes particular scientific questions come to be widely perceived as important, perhaps even decisive, for policy decisions. ), the significance of the human contribution to a naturally occurring change, or discrepancies in data records or observational techniques. If the policy debate on an issue is characterized by controversy or deadlock because conflicting claims are being made about key scientific questions, an assessment can inform and advance the policy debate by authoritatively resolving these questions.

SOURCE: GCRP 1989. 1 Chart framework • Process research to enhance understanding of the physical, geological, chemical, biological, and social processes that influence Earth system behavior; and integrated modeling and prediction of Earth system processes. In FY 1994, a new program element was added: assessment activities. Several criteria, although not applied systematically, were used to evaluate projects under each research element, including relevance and contribution to the overall goal of the program, scientific merit, ease or readiness of implementation, links to other agencies and international partners, cost, and agency approval.
